in

Percabangan pada javascript

logo javascript


Kali ini saya akan membahas mengenai percabangann pada javascript . Karean di artikel sebelumnya  saya sudah janji akan membahas percabangan pada javascript dan membahas operator perbandingan pada javascript . Baik pertama tama kita bahas mengenai percabangan dulu. Percabangan merupakan salah satu struktur dasar pada algoritma .

Jadi memahami percabangan itu wajib, tidak hanya untuk perprograman javascript saja tetapi yang lain juga ada percabangan. Jadi kalo kalian paham percabangan . Tenang saja percabangan itu mudah kok . Pertama sebelum kita ngoding, saya akan jelasakan dulu apa itu percabangan . Percabangan diibaratkan kita memiliki nilai ulangan fisika 98 sedangakan kkm di sekolah kita adalah 75, nah maka karena kita memiliki nilai ulangan fisika 98 maka kita tidak mengikuti remedial sedangkan jika nilai ulangan fisika kita lebih kecil dari 75 maka akan mengikuti remedial .  Jadi percabangan itu memiliki lebih dari dua perintah, misal kita memenuhi sesuai dengan syarat maka akan melakukan perintah1 dan jika tidak maka akan mengikuti perintah2.

Baca juga struktur dasar pada algoritma yang lainnya .

Jika masih bingung kita lanjut saja ke kodingan supaya dengan kita ngoding jadi paham . Baik penulisan percabangan di javascript cukup mudah . Struktur penulisannya

if(kondisi){
  //perintah memenuhi
}else{
  //perintah tidak memenuhi
}

Sekarang kita coba, membuatnya kita ambil contoh saja yang seperti di atas.

<h1>Status remedial dan tidak remedial ulangan fisika</h1>
<script language=”javascript”>
<!–
var nilai_fisika=98;
if(nilai_fisika>=75){ //kondisi memenuhi
document.write(“Anda tidak mengikuti remedial karena nilai anda “+nilai_fisika+
” dan lebih besar dari 75″);
}else{ //kondisi tidak memenuhi
document.write(“Anda mengikuti remedial karena nilai anda di bawah 75”);
}
//>
</script>

Contohnya seperti yang di atas adalah akan melakukan perintah yang

 document.write(“Anda tidak mengikuti remedial karena nilai anda “+nilai_fisika+
” dan lebih besar dari 75″);

Karena ketika kita nilai kita di bandingan yaitu yang if(nilai_fisika>=75){ ,artinya jika nilai_fisika lebih besar atau sama dengan 75 maka akan melakukan perintah  

 document.write(“Anda tidak mengikuti remedial karena nilai anda “+nilai_fisika+
” dan lebih besar dari 75″);

dan jika tidak maka akan melakukan perintah yang else

document.write(“Anda mengikuti remedial karena nilai anda di bawah 75”);

Baik kembali lagi sekarang saya akan bahas operator perbandingan . jadi salah satunya operator perbandingan yang >=, itu salah satunya bisa juga <, >, ==, <= . Seperti biasa kita gunakan di if dasarnya .

Baca juga operator pada javascript

Mungkin itu dia bahas bahas mengenai percabangan pada javascript, kalo tidak jelas bisa di comment di komentar, kalo jelas alhamdulillah . Terakhir semoga bermanfaat dan sampai jumpa .

Written by Bago Cyber